Step 4 — Configure Idempotency Keys (Tollgate Payments)

Before promoting the release, verify that retry deduplication is active. The retry worker derives idempotency keys by signing each payment attempt, so duplicate submissions from the Marlin checkout flow are rejected rather than double-charged. Confirm TOLLGATE_IDEMPOTENCY_TTL is set to 86400 in the release .env — shorter values risk replays after network partitions. The signing step itself needs a credential, which must appear in the same file on the next line:

env line for yajep-bajof: ARCHIVE_KEY3=015

MEMO — Spare parts shipment, Kelswick Relay Station

To the receiving site: the crate of spare parts for the antenna array — two feed assemblies, cabling, and mounting hardware — leaves our Dorvane warehouse Monday. Expect arrival Wednesday afternoon, weather permitting. Check contents against the packing list before signing, and store the feed assemblies indoors. When the courier arrives, carry out the confidential hand-over instruction given below:

handover note for yagef-bagep: the drudor pelius courier leaves the kasdor zorvan norir ledger at gate 8016 under passcode 755406

Migration step 4 — FeedLint validator cutover. Stop the legacy PodCheck workers before running the schema migration; they hold long transactions and will block the alter. Run `feedlint migrate --apply` from the bastion, confirm row counts match the preflight report, then re-enable ingestion. Rollback script lives in the migrate/rollback dir. The validator reads its target database at boot, so point it at the migrated instance using the string below.

replica DSN, kajep-yahag: mssql://praok_svc:iF@db-8d68.plorvaio.local:5432/eliion